Hi Guix,

I am translating Guix to the Tamil language. Tamil doesn't yet have a
very standardized technical vocabulary, and I mostly coin terms on my
own. Most often, I construct calques of existing English words, and it
sounds alright. But, I'm having trouble with the word "derivation" (as
in Guix's low-level build actions). I haven't seen the word "derivation"
used anywhere outside of Guix. Why is a "low-level build action" called
a "derivation"? If someone could clarify the etymology, it might really
help with good translation.
